If you have been wondering how to romanticize your life without ignoring reality, the answer is not perfection. It is presence, beauty, and grounded intention.

There is a reason so many people are drawn to the idea of romanticizing their life. Modern life can feel rushed, repetitive, and emotionally dry. Days blur together. You wake up tired, look at screens too much, carry stress everywhere, and sometimes forget that your life is made up of moments, not just responsibilities. Romanticizing your life is a way of returning to those moments.

But there is an important difference between romanticizing your life and escaping reality. A healthy version of this practice does not deny your problems or force fake positivity. It simply teaches you to bring more beauty, attention, softness, and meaning into your real life as it already exists. It is not about pretending. It is about noticing.

What it really means to romanticize your life

To romanticize your life means to stop living as if your happiness only begins after everything is fixed. It means deciding that ordinary moments still deserve your presence. Your tea in the morning matters. The way you arrange your desk matters. The walk home in the evening matters. The music you play while getting ready matters. These details may seem small, but they change how life feels from the inside.

A beautiful life is often built through attention, not luxury.

Start with your senses

One of the easiest ways to romanticize daily life is through sensory detail. Open the curtains in the morning. Light a candle while journaling. Drink water from a glass you actually like. Play music while cleaning your room. Wear perfume even when you are staying home. Make your routines feel more textured and alive. When your senses are more engaged, your life feels less flat.

This is not about being extravagant. It is about learning to participate in your own life more fully. Even a very simple routine can feel beautiful when you stop rushing through it mindlessly.

    Create rituals around ordinary moments

    Rituals are one of the most powerful ways to make life feel richer. A ritual does not need to be spiritual or complicated. It just needs to be intentional. Your evening shower can become a reset ritual. Your Sunday room clean can become a fresh-start ritual. Your study setup can become a focus ritual. What makes a ritual special is not the action itself, but the care you bring into it.

    This is especially helpful if you have been feeling disconnected or emotionally numb. Rituals bring meaning back into the structure of your days. They make life feel inhabited again.

    Stop waiting for perfect conditions

    A lot of people delay joy because they think life has to become easier first. They tell themselves they will enjoy things more after exams, after they move, after they have more money, after they lose weight, after they become more successful. But a romanticized life does not begin when everything is ideal. It begins when you decide to stop withholding beauty from yourself.

    That does not mean ignoring real difficulties. It means refusing to let difficulty erase your ability to notice goodness. Both can exist at once. You can be stressed and still enjoy your tea. You can be healing and still wear a nice outfit. You can be uncertain and still make your room feel peaceful.

    Romanticizing life without becoming unrealistic

    There is a grounded way to do this and an avoidant way to do this. The grounded way adds beauty while still staying honest about your life. The avoidant way uses aesthetics to hide what needs to be addressed. If your room looks pretty but your nervous system is exhausted, both matter. If your morning routine looks calm but your boundaries are weak, that matters too. The goal is not to decorate dysfunction. The goal is to create a life that feels both beautiful and healthy.

    This is where romanticizing your life connects naturally with glow-up habits, journaling, and soft productivity. Beauty without alignment feels empty. Alignment without beauty can feel dry. Together, they create a more nourishing life.
